Joining host Jim Holthus in the booth will be Deanna Roach of Baja Designs, Mike Badami, FULL CIRCLE Director and Producer of Pinned TV, Fred Helms, Director of FULL CIRCLE and Co-Producer of Pinned TV, and John Barnes, legendary off road racer. John finished third overall in the first Baja 1000 in 1967, then known as the NORRA Mexican 1000. John was teamed with Dick Hansen, finishing minutes behind the team of Malcolm Smith/JN Roberts, second overall/first motorcycle and the team of Vic Wilson/ Ted Mangels, first overall/first 4-wheel.
